WebJul 13, 2024 · Tablet dimensions (tablet size) involve the length, width and depth of the device, while the screen size is measured diagonally across the device. If a tablet has a large amount of "dead" space between the end of the screen and the end of the tablet, it can make a smaller-screened tablet bulkier and heavier than necessary. How to Measure Laptop Size Manually
WebMar 31, 2024 · Converting Centimeters To Inches. If you’ve measured the size of your laptop’s screen in centimeters, it’s easy to turn that number into inches. 1 inch = 2.54 CM. For example, if your screen is 34 cm wide, you would divide that number by 2.54 cm to get inches. 34 CM (measured screen size) :2.54 CM (1 inch is 2.54 CM) = 13.3 inches. WebScreen size measures how big the display is. It's measured diagonally, with commons sizes of 12 to 15 inches. A bigger screen will allow you to see more windows and apps at once, though the screen will weigh more than a smaller screen. Resolution measures how many pixels are on your screen. The more pixels, the sharper your display will be.
